Transaction 8639a05e027e922e986ca774ba91f3e9caf2138ac52879705320383737c2ee83
1 Input
1 Output
-
8639a05e027e922e986ca774ba91f3e9caf2138ac52879705320383737c2ee83:0
- value
- 1042813
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4c43b096e996fccfc3e8ed2c94c5fec6ef1a3601 OP_EQUAL
- address
- 38eGNHwGr7F7Rh7xzepdEZ6RBh9oN5r9Uv